THIS IS A NATIONAL GUARD TITLE 32 EXCEPTED SERVICE POSITION. This National Guard position is for a HUMAN RESOURCES SPECIALIST (MILITARY) (TITLE 32), Position Description Number NGD1622000 and is part of the TN 118th WING Air National Guard. Note: This position is physically located at the Tennessee Joint Force Headquarters/A1, 3041 Sidco Drive, Nashville, TN 37204. THIS POSITION MAY BE ELIGIBLE FOR RECRUITMENT OR RELOCATION INCENTIVE UNDER QUALIFYING FACTORS.
Military Grades: E-5 through E-7 Compatible Military Assignments: 3F0X1 GENERAL EXPERIENCE: Must have experience gained through military or civilian technical training schools, within the human resources business programs, are included as general experience qualifications. An applicant must have a validated understanding of the basic principles and concepts of the occupational series and grade. SPECIALIZED EXPERIENCE: Must have 24 months specialized experience or training or at least one year of specialized experience at the GS-07 level or the equivalent, which provided a basic working knowledge of National Guard missions, organizations, and personnel programs. Must have a basic knowledge and experiences of personnel programs gained in a classroom or as an on-the-job trainee. Have knowledge-based competency of human resources elements and can discuss terminology, concepts, principles, and issues related to this competency. Experience in using references and resource materials and experience in program functions such as, maintaining personnel records, counseling, or classification and assignments. Experience may include performing personnel functions associated with preparing and maintaining position descriptions and manual records, personnel classification or usage, quality force management, managing personnel records and researching record data. Experience in operating a computer and using varied computer programs. Experience in human resources programs related to Career Enhancements, Customer Service, Employments, Relocations, and or Readiness. Perform other duties as required.
As a HUMAN RESOURCE SPECIALIST (TITLE 32/MILTARY), GS-0201-09, you will serve as advisor to commanders on assigned unit human resources (HR) programs. Plan, direct, control and provide advisory services on all aspects of the Career Enhancement program for both Active Guard Reserve (AGR), unit drill status guardsmen, full time technicians and potential members. Plan, direct, and control all aspects of the Customer Service Program, human resources employment program, and the Relocation program for all members. Ensure accuracy of human resources data system and perform functional review of data reliability relative to the relocations program. Develop wing readiness plans for the administration of contingencies and mobilizations. Manage contingency and exercise deployments. Serve as Classified Control Officer responsible for safeguarding and proper destruction of classified material IAW AF instructions, higher headquarters and local guidance. Responsible to the Joint Force Headquarters Director of Staff-Air for personnel and administrative support to the staff and three Air Wings across the State of Tennessee. Perform other duties as assigned.
